
Following successful angioplasty of the right coronary lesion, the exercise test was repeated. The ECG shown here was recorded immediately following exercise. It is now normal with no evidence of ST segment depression. It indicates that the diffuse exercise-induced ST segment depression was the result of non-transmural (or sub-endocardial) ischemic in the region supplied by the stenotic right coronary artery and that this ischemic region was not identified by the leads in which the ST segment depression was present.
